About Heather
Heather Swann received her bachelor's degree in Psychology and Sociology from Suffolk University In 2002 where she graduated magna cum laude. She later went on to complete her juris doctorate at Western New England College School of Law in 2006.
During law school, Ms. Swann spent her summers volunteering as a legal intern at the State's Attorneys' Offices in New London and Norwich, Connecticut. While attending her last year of law school, Ms. Swann represented the Commonwealth of Massachusetts as a student Assistant District Attorney in the Massachusetts District Court.
While working at the District Attorneys' Office, Ms. Swann gained valuable experience in negotiations, advocacy, and the various aspects of litigation.
After graduating from law school, Ms. Swann was admitted to the Connecticut State Bar in October of 2006. In August of 2007, Ms. Swann relocated to Washington State and was admitted to the Washington State Bar in May of 2007. She Is currently a member of the Washington State Bar Association and the Tacoma Pierce County Bar Association.
In November of 2007, Ms. Swann joined the Hay Law Firm, P.S. as a new associate. She intends to utilize her litigation and negotiation skills in the civil arena. Ms. Swann is practicing in the areas of family law, consumer protection, real estate, personal injury, and trusts and estates.
